Usage Note
Klagebefugnis is the procedural requirement that a plaintiff must be affected in their own rights to be allowed to bring an action. Courts dismiss cases ab limine if Klagebefugnis is absent.
Examples
"Das Gericht verneinte die Klagebefugnis, weil der Kläger nicht unmittelbar betroffen war."
Natural Translation
The court denied standing to sue because the plaintiff was not directly affected.
Literal Translation
The court denied the right-to-sue, because the plaintiff not directly affected was.
